Description:
A romantic view of Kyrenia Gate or Proveditore after the proveditore Francesco Barbaro.The gate was one of the three on the walls of Nicosia leading into the town and next to the Barbaro Bastion. It was repaired by the Turks in 1821 , a square chamber added above it and a large panel with verses from the Koran above the doorway. In 1932 the British cut the walls left and right of the gate to allow for two roads to lead traffic in and out of the city. The watercolor was obviously made before 1932.
